## Notice

The Council has been using Project Online Web App (PWA) as the primary Project and Portfolio Management (PPM) platform for several years, alongside: integration with Microsoft Project, Power BI reporting packs, workflow tools (e.g., stage-gate progression and approvals), SharePoint project sites, and in-house finance systems. The Council seeks to understand market capabilities for either: (a) a like-for-like replacement of key Project Online/PWA functionality including integration with Microsoft Project (if possible), retention of Power BI reporting packs, retention of workflow tools such as stage gates, and integration with in-house finance systems; and/or (b) a modern, comprehensive PPM platform that additionally provides resource management, roadmapping, portfolio prioritisation, and benefits realisation. The desired outcome is to maintain or enhance governance workflows; maintain or enhance reporting; achieve robust integration to in-house finance systems; provide modern portfolio management; improve resource management; offer roadmapping; ensure usability; support security and compliance; and minimise total cost of ownership.
